Tender description

The University wishes to procure a fully integrated, cloud-based, HR and Payroll system which is accessible by all employees and empowers managers through access to team data via self-service. An integrated HR and Payroll solution is required to support core human resources and payroll administrative processes, provide self-service for employees and managers and support HR policy and guidance and case management, covering the following areas: Vacancy management, recruitment and selection Organisational and employee data Workforce management, analytics and planning Engagement and development Occupational health and safety Benefits, pay and pensions Leavers Communication and correspondence Statutory and internal reporting An integrated HR and Payroll solution will: Enable the University to improve process efficiency and rationalise existing systems Enable at least 500 substantive, 80 sessional and 170 casual members of staff access and use relevant parts of the system Provide employee and manager self-service and workflow functionality Provide seamless and effective links between other corporate information systems Allow the University to run up to 4 PAYE payrolls and multiple pensions for approx. 750 staff (including staff with multiple posts & pensions) Allow the University to meet its obligations in respect to The Welsh Language Standards
